Spanish Reconquista
The period from the 8th to the 15th century during which Christian kingdoms in the Iberian Peninsula reconquered territory from Muslim rulers.
Aztec Empire
A Mesoamerican empire that flourished in central Mexico in the 14th, 15th, and early 16th centuries, known for its sophisticated civilization, architectural achievements, and complex social structure before falling to Spanish conquerors.
Hernán Cortés
A Spanish Conquistador known for his expedition that led to the fall of the Aztec Empire and the establishment of Mexico City on its ruins.
Bartolome De Las Casas
A 16th-century Spanish historian and Dominican friar who became the first known advocate for the rights of indigenous people in the Americas, and opposed the abuses of the Spanish encomienda system.
